DataSet2) in chunks to the existing DF to be quite feasible. DataSet1) as a Pandas DF and appending the other (e.g. When I open the save file with microsoft office,the displayed data has no milliseconds,But when I use notepad++ to open the csv, I can see milliseconds, I think this is indeed a problem with the compiler. df.to_csv('NamesAndAges.csv') Code language: Python (python) Here’s how the exported dataframe … Index will be included as the first field of the record array if requested. If you have set a float_format then floats are converted to strings and thus csv.QUOTE_NONNUMERIC will treat them as non-numeric.. quotechar str, default ‘"’. In the example below we don’t use any parameters but the path_or_buf which is, in our case, the file name. Character used to quote fields. However, I still need to save my file after I perform my computations. Step 3: Get from Pandas DataFrame to SQL. About Us Learn more about Stack Overflow the company ... (loading & appending multi-GB csv files), I found @user666's option of loading one data set (e.g. If you have a function that takes the data as (say) the second argument, pass a tuple indicating which keyword expects the data. 2 min read. By using our site, you acknowledge that you have read and understand our Cookie Policy, Privacy Policy, and our Terms of Service. data.csv name,physics,chemistry,algebra Somu,68,84,78 Kiku,74,56,88 Amol,77,73,82 Lini,78,69,87 . Output: Original DataFrame: Name Age 0 Amit 20 1 Cody 21 2 Drew 25 Data from Users.csv: Name\tAge 0 Amit\t20 1 Cody\t21 2 Drew\t25 I propose a function, which can be called on a DataFrame, named to_tsv or to_table. Viewed 4k times 1. during save length is of 33000 and . python code examples for pandas.DataFrame.to_csv. Parameter Description; path_or_buf: string or file handle, default None File path or object, if None is provided the result is returned as a string. In this article, we are using “nba.csv” file to download the CSV, click here. By using our site, you acknowledge that you have read and understand our Cookie Policy, Privacy Policy, and our Terms of Service. I’ve already written a detailed post titled Pandas DataFrame : A Lightweight Intro. The function is the equivalent of to_csv() with the argument sep='\t'.While to_tsv() contains the functionality to write tsv files, I find it annoying to always have to specify an additional argument. Photo by AbsolutVision on Unsplash Short Answer. Learn how to use python api pandas.DataFrame.to_csv Stack Overflow for Teams is a private, secure spot for you and your coworkers to find and share information. quoting optional constant from csv module. However, I still need to save my file after I perform my computations. You can also provide a link from the web. In this post, we’re going to see how we can load, store and play with CSV files using Pandas DataFrame. Creates data dictionary and converts it into dataframe 2. After working on a dataset and doing all the preprocessing we need to save the preprocessed data into some format like in csv , excel or others. Save pandas dataframe to a csv file; Series; Shifting and Lagging Data; Simple manipulation of DataFrames; String manipulation; Using .ix, .iloc, .loc, .at and .iat to access a DataFrame ; Working with Time Series; Looking for pandas Answers? It's a display problem. Here is the full Python code to get from pandas DataFrame to SQL: import sqlite3 from pandas import DataFrame conn = sqlite3.connect('TestDB1.db') c = conn.cursor() … So I am performing some computation on csv file which I uploaded to tables in dataframe and need to save the dataframe in csv format. say the result is /home/amir. Saving Pandas Dataframe to CSV. Defaults to csv.QUOTE_MINIMAL. Aug 18, 2019 - I have a dataframe in pandas which I would like to write to a CSV file. Stack Overflow for Teams is a private, secure spot for you and your coworkers to find and share information. (max 2 MiB). For example, you might want to use a different separator, change the datetime format, or drop the index when writing. I've written a python script that takes in a file and matches some columns in another file. The two primary data structures of pandas, Series (1-dimensional) and DataFrame (2-dimensional), handle the vast majority of typical use cases in finance, statistics, social science, and many areas of engineering. Save the dataframe called “df” as csv. Active 2 years, 4 months ago. I load a very large csv file in a gz format in Pandas 0.18 using. This python source code does the following : 1. In the screenshot below we call this file “whatever_name_you_want.csv”. DataFrame.iat. Return a reshaped DataFrame or Series having a multi-level index with one or more new inner-most levels compared to the current DataFrame. In this post you can find information about several topics related to files - text and CSV and pandas dataframes. Here in this tutorial, we will do the following things to understand exporting pandas DataFrame to CSV file: Create a new DataFrame. The post is appropriate for complete beginners and include full code examples and results. import pandas … See also. Write Pandas Dataframe to CSV with a variable name in pathway. In this tutorial, you are going to learn how to Export Pandas DataFrame to the CSV File in Python programming language. Importing CSV Data Into a Pandas DataFrame. I am familiar with how to do this on apache Spark, using the same syntax once I save it in databricks I am … Recap on Pandas DataFrame . Basic Structure Note: I’ve commented out this line of code so it does not run. DataFrame.loc. Can to_csv store my dataframe in a gz format? Have you checked the contents of your csv using a text editor or were you checking using Excel or something similar? Description; Transcript ; Comments & Discussion (9) This is the first video of the course and defines the objectives of this course. The only related question I found on StackOverflow is 3 year old... You could use the parameter compression='gzip', Click here to upload your image Stack Exchange network consists of 176 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. Export the DataFrame to CSV File. Learn more . Access a single value for a row/column pair by integer position. Looking for pandas Keywords? And when I tried with csv and read back it shows very few elements from the list i.e. In this example, we take the following csv file and load it into a DataFrame using pandas.read_csv() method. String of length 1. pandas documentation: Save pandas dataframe to a csv file. Click here to upload your image I use this code to export data from cassandra to csv: But when I open the csv, I find that there are no milliseconds in the date, like this: Actually there are milliseconds in the dataframe, like this: How can I save milliseconds into csv,I want %Y-%m-%d %H:%M:%S.%f? filter_none. Stack Overflow. Pandas DataFrames 101 Mahdi Yusuf 02:16 Mark as Completed. DataFrame.to_csv() Pandas has a built in function called to_csv() which can be called on a DataFrame object to write to a CSV file. The newline character or character sequence to use in the output file. Now we are ready to learn how to save Pandas dataframe to CSV. Export Pandas DataFrame to the CSV File. In this tutorial, we will learn different scenarios that occur while loading data from CSV to Pandas DataFrame. how can I save a Pandas dataframe into a compressed csv file? astype() function also provides the capability to convert any suitable existing column to categorical type. I load a very large csv file in a gz format in Pandas 0.18 using. Python Program. This function offers many arguments with reasonable defaults that you will more often than not need to override to suit your specific use case. By clicking “Post Your Answer”, you agree to our terms of service, privacy policy and cookie policy, 2020 Stack Exchange, Inc. user contributions under cc by-sa, https://stackoverflow.com/questions/36254063/how-can-i-save-a-pandas-dataframe-into-a-compressed-csv-file/36254113#36254113. Cast a pandas object to a specified dtype. Learn more Pandas dataframe can't save milliseconds to csv I am doing this using: df.to_csv('out.csv') And getting the error: UnicodeEncodeError: 'ascii' … Visit Stack … Ask Question Asked 2 years, 11 months ago. For R users, DataFrame provides everything that R’s data.frame provides and much more. Saves it in CSV format So this is the recipe on how we can save Pandas DataFrame as CSV file. I prefer tsv files to csv files because tabs more rarely occur and therefore decrease the need for escaping. Access a group of rows and columns by label(s). You can also provide a link from the web. It’s quite simple, we write the dataframe to CSV file using Pandas to_csv method. What compiler? pandas.DataFrame.to_records¶ DataFrame.to_records (index = True, column_dtypes = None, index_dtypes = None) [source] ¶ Convert DataFrame to a NumPy record array. Try Ask4Keywords. edit close. If you’re not comfortable with Pandas DataFrame, I’ll highly recommend you to have a look at this post before continuing with this one. You can use the following template in Python in order to export your Pandas DataFrame to a CSV file: df.to_csv(r'Path where you want to store the exported CSV file\File Name.csv', index = False) And if you wish to include the index, then simply remove “ , index = False ” from the code: You can use the following syntax to get from pandas DataFrame to SQL: df.to_sql('CARS', conn, if_exists='replace', index = False) Where CARS is the table name created in step 2. Without surprise, once the csv is unzipped and loaded into the RAM, it takes a lot of space. Can to_csv store my dataframe in a gz format? About; Products For Teams; Stack Overflow Public questions & answers;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Jobs Programming & related technical career opportunities; Talent Recruit … DataFrame.astype() function is used to cast a pandas object to a specified dtype. so first check you user directory by executing echo $HOME. pandas Parsing date columns with read_csv Example. Your working directory is /usr/share, and saving/deleting/copy/move actions in /user directory requires sudo privileges. pandas.DataFrame.stack¶ DataFrame.stack (level = - 1, dropna = True) [source] ¶ Stack the prescribed level(s) from columns to index. By clicking “Post Your Answer”, you agree to our terms of service, privacy policy and cookie policy, 2020 Stack Exchange, Inc. user contributions under cc by-sa. Saving a pandas dataframe as a CSV. pd=pd.read_csv('myfile.gz') Without surprise, once the csv is unzipped and loaded into the RAM, it takes a lot of space. I am trying to convert a list of lists which looks like the following into a Pandas Dataframe [['New York Yankees ', '"Acevedo Juan" ', 900000, ' Pitcher\n'], ['New York Yankees ', '"Anderson Ja... Stack Exchange Network . The covered topics are: Convert text file to dataframe Convert CSV file to dataframe Convert dataframe Use this option if you need a different delimiter, for instance pd.read_csv('data_file.csv', sep=';') index_col With index_col = n ( n an integer) you tell pandas to use column n to index the DataFrame. Than not need to learn how to Export Pandas DataFrame: a Lightweight Intro for beginners. It does not run because tabs more rarely occur and therefore decrease the need for escaping I ’ already... Surprise, once the CSV file file in a gz format understand exporting Pandas DataFrame DataFrame provides everything that ’. Multi-Level index with one or more new inner-most levels compared to the CSV file: Create a new.! Example, we will do the following things to understand exporting Pandas DataFrame the output file s quite simple we. How can I save a Pandas DataFrame to CSV file in a gz format in Pandas which I like! Data type the web used to cast a Pandas DataFrame to CSV with a variable name in pathway a! Pandas save pandas dataframe to csv stack overflow to a CSV file and matches some columns in another file R users, DataFrame provides that... Data.Frame provides and much more using a text editor or were you checking using Excel or similar! Compressed CSV file in a file and load it into a Pandas df and appending the other ( e.g DataFrame... This function offers many arguments with reasonable defaults that you will more often than not to. Upload your image ( max 2 MiB ) CSV files because tabs more rarely and. A link from the web a variable name in pathway checked the contents of CSV... Things to understand exporting Pandas DataFrame file and load it into a Pandas df appending! Categorical type this line of code so it does not run it into DataFrame! File in python Pandas and load it into DataFrame 2 on StackOverflow Apply! We ’ re going to see how we can save Pandas DataFrame related Question I found on StackOverflow, GZIP... Several topics related to files - text and CSV and read back it shows very few elements from list! Or drop the index when writing by integer position by integer position more. Ask Question Asked 2 years, 11 months ago will do the following to. Format in Pandas which I would like to write to a CSV in python programming.... Get from Pandas DataFrame as CSV row/column pair by integer position R,... Always have a DataFrame using pandas.read_csv ( ) method code does the following CSV file using Pandas DataFrame SQL! To_Tsv or to_table format in Pandas 0.18 using and CSV and read back it shows very few elements from web! I prefer tsv files to CSV with a variable name in pathway of code save pandas dataframe to csv stack overflow it does not.. Step 3: Get from Pandas DataFrame to SQL astype ( ) method not need to save my file I! Files - text and CSV and read back it shows very few elements from the list.! 1: Convert the Weight column data type DataFrame 2 a different separator, change the datetime,. Be quite feasible RAM, it takes a lot of space, which be. Saving Pandas DataFrame to the current DataFrame will learn different scenarios that while. Or were you checking using Excel or something similar using “ nba.csv ” file to download the file! To adjust the display of datetime values in Excel CSV is unzipped and into! That occur while loading data from CSV to Pandas DataFrame can be called on a DataFrame, to_tsv! And converts it into DataFrame 2 chemistry, algebra Somu,68,84,78 Kiku,74,56,88 Amol,77,73,82 Lini,78,69,87 adjust the display of datetime values Excel! The Weight column data type R users, DataFrame provides everything that R ’ s quite simple we! Existing df to be quite feasible and results often than not need to save file. With one or more new inner-most levels compared to the existing df to be quite feasible case the... And loaded into the function is the recipe on how we can save Pandas DataFrame I... T use any parameters but the path_or_buf which is, in our case, the name! Separator, change the datetime format, or drop the index when writing Series having a multi-level index with or! The other ( e.g surprise, once the CSV is unzipped and loaded into RAM. File: Create a new DataFrame going to see how we can load, and... Python Pandas into the RAM, it takes a lot of space learn to! Value for a row/column pair by integer position ( df re going to learn how to adjust display... Following: 1 chunks to the CSV is unzipped and loaded into the function is used to a! Executing echo $ HOME t use any parameters but the path_or_buf which is, in our case, file. As arg2: > > > > ( df or drop the index when writing to find share! A detailed post titled Pandas DataFrame to SQL.csv file to download the is..Csv file to DataFrame Convert CSV file in a gz format in Pandas using! Code examples and results don ’ t use any parameters but the path_or_buf which,... Whatever_Name_You_Want.Csv ” and loaded into the RAM, it save pandas dataframe to csv stack overflow a lot of space code... The output file find and share information DataFrame 2 find and share.... I found on StackOverflow, Apply GZIP compression to a CSV file nba.csv file. Re going to see how we can load, store and play with CSV and read back shows! Will do the following CSV file and load it into DataFrame 2 we ’ re going to learn to. The path_or_buf which is, in our case, the file name write the.csv file.... I found on StackOverflow, Apply GZIP compression to a CSV file or. In Pandas 0.18 using saves it in CSV format so this is the name! Step 3: Get from Pandas DataFrame to CSV file often than not need to learn to! Occur while loading data from CSV to Pandas DataFrame to CSV a single value for row/column... A single value for a row/column pair by integer position using Excel or something similar provides and much more and! In python programming language to cast a Pandas DataFrame to CSV file using Pandas DataFrame the. - text and CSV and Pandas dataframes 101 Mahdi Yusuf 02:16 Mark as Completed detailed titled. First check you user directory by executing echo $ HOME other ( e.g and your to... The post is appropriate for complete beginners and include full code examples and results share... Already written a python script that takes in a gz format in Pandas which I would like write. 101 Mahdi Yusuf 02:16 Mark as Completed that you will more often than not need to save Pandas DataFrame a. We call this file “ whatever_name_you_want.csv ” data into a compressed CSV file: Create new... Store my DataFrame in Pandas 0.18 using 2 years, 11 months ago for Teams is a,! Surprise, once the CSV, click here to upload your image ( 2... Data type for you and your coworkers to find and share information checking using Excel or similar. For R users, DataFrame provides everything that R ’ s data.frame provides much. 1: Convert text file to value for a row/column pair by position! The newline character or character sequence to use a different separator, change the datetime format or! Back it shows very few elements from the list i.e more often than not need to my! A Lightweight Intro “ nba.csv ” file to DataFrame Convert CSV file in a file load! The index when writing upload your image ( max 2 MiB ), in our case, the name. Suit your specific use case provides and much more executing echo $ HOME object to CSV! Are using “ nba.csv ” file to download the CSV is unzipped and into... A text editor or save pandas dataframe to csv stack overflow you checking using Excel or something similar ’ s data.frame and. Pandas to_csv method in save pandas dataframe to csv stack overflow CSV in python programming language are: Convert the column... I 've written a python script that takes in a gz format in Pandas 0.18 using quite feasible Teams a! Suitable existing column to categorical type the covered topics are: Convert the Weight column data.... To override to suit your specific use case large CSV file and matches columns! Different scenarios that occur while loading data from CSV to Pandas DataFrame to CSV files using Pandas to_csv.. Cast a Pandas DataFrame as CSV whatever_name_you_want.csv ” chemistry, algebra Somu,68,84,78 Kiku,74,56,88 Lini,78,69,87...: > > > > > > ( df a single value for a row/column by... Code so it does not run out this line of code so it not. Dataframe: a Lightweight Intro Lightweight Intro path_or_buf which is, in our case, the file name pathway. This tutorial, you are going to see how we can save Pandas DataFrame to CSV file in a format! Code examples and results the display of datetime values in Excel include full code examples and results code so does. Gzip compression to a specified dtype and read back it shows very few elements the. Source code does the following things to understand exporting Pandas DataFrame tried with CSV files using Pandas:. Values in Excel having a multi-level index with one or more new inner-most levels compared to CSV... Data.Csv name, physics, chemistry, algebra Somu,68,84,78 Kiku,74,56,88 Amol,77,73,82 Lini,78,69,87 Get from Pandas DataFrame: a Intro! Path_Or_Buf which is, in our case, the file name tutorial, you are going see... Your CSV using a text editor or were you checking using Excel or something?... The output file DataFrame provides everything that R ’ s quite simple, we take the following: 1 Somu,68,84,78... The other ( e.g Aug 18, 2019 - I have a … Pandas. Or drop the index when writing different scenarios that occur while loading data from CSV to Pandas DataFrame as....